Our mission? Making day-to-day banking easier for SMEs and freelancers thanks to an online business account that's combined with invoicing, bookkeeping and spend management tools. Thanks to its innovative product, highly reactive 24/7 customer support and clear pricing, Qonto has become the leader in its market.

Our journey: Founded by Alexandre and Steve in July 2017, Qonto has rapidly gained trust, serving over 500,000 customers. Thanks to our wonderful team of 1,600+ Qontoers, we also made it to the LinkedIn Top Companies French ranking!

As a Talent Acquisition Intern, you will join a team of 25+ Talent Acquisition Managers spread in different subteams: Tech, product, and Business (Corporate, Growth and Operations).

You will closely with the Talent Acquisition Managers. Your mission will be to support the team by working on several projects and coordinating all interview processes, as well as hiring our intern profiles. You will play a key role in the success of the team.

👩‍💻🧑‍💻 As a Talent Acquisition Intern at Qonto, you will

• Help Talent Acquisition Managers: You will help analyze the labour market to find relevant candidates, you will identify relevant profiles and organize interviews; • Hire the right talent for our internships: You will identify potential talents through CVs and sourcing, to hire our future interns; • Make the process more efficient by identifying pain points and thinking about potential improvements; • Support our Talent Acquisition strategy by helping on several continuous improvement projects (e.g. campus management, perk and salary benchmarks, employer branding, tools improvements, etc).

🏅About You

• Organisational skills: You are hands-on and able to multitask and prioritize your daily workload with autonomy; • Problem solver: Nothing can stop you! • Communication skills: You have an impactful presentation style: you will represent Qonto, and you have outstanding communication & interpersonal skills; • Languages: You speak both French and English; • Education: You have or are pursuing a French Master's or equivalent degree in Human Resources Management or in a relevant field, and are looking for your end-of-study internship.
